WWII GERMAN WALTHER "ac 45" MARKED P.38 9mm PISTOL | Late WWII German Walther model P.38 "ac 45" marked 9mm semi-automatic pistol. Pistol features blued finish, brown ribbed bakelite grips, and matching serial numbers on slide, frame and barrel. Barrel stamped with "WaA76" waffenamt (Bohmische Waffenfabrik, Prag) code. Left side of slide reads: "P.38," "5256b," and "ac 45." Left side of frame marked: "5256b," and "359" waffenamt. Left side of barrel double stamped with "WaA76" waffenamt. Right side of slide stamped with two "359" waffenamts, and WWII German eagle. Magazine stamped: "P.38," "359," "WaA706," waffenamts and "jvd." No visible import markings. | Caliber / Gauge: 9mm | Barrel Length: 5" | Serial Number: 5256b | Condition: Very good. Bright bore, with very good rifling. Metal surfaces show approximately 85-90% original finish, with some minor handling wear and light fading of lettering. Grips show very minor handling wear. Smooth, crisp action. Mechanically excellent. Black post war leather holster. Beautiful piece of WWII history, investment quality firearm. Mn buyer needs Mn state ID and permit.
